Key Topics We Address
- Residential schedule and exchanges (week-to-week, 2-2-3, 2-2-5-5, 7-7, etc.)
- Decision-making responsibilities (education, health, religion, activities)
- Holidays & special days (school breaks, birthdays, Mother’s/Father’s Day)
- Communication protocols between parents and with children
- Travel & mobility (consents, passports, itinerary sharing)
- Health & education information sharing
- Special needs, therapies, and support services
- Dispute-resolution steps (check-ins, mediation clauses, review dates)
